The garden is the largest park in the city by far. You can rent bikes, segways, golf cars, two seat bikes that look like go-carts, and 4 seat bikes that look like golf cars.
The villa is filled with art. The most well known pieces by Bernini are here. Each room was floor to ceiling art. The artists lived on the property as they worked on each room. It was nice to see the art IN the space that it was designed for.
There was also a train that took us around the massive park that use to be the Medici's backyard.
